Kinds Of Bunk Beds for Teens
When it concerns choosing a bunk bed for teens, the options are large. Here's a comprehensive introduction of the various types offered:
Type of Bunk Bed
Description
Standard Bunk Bed
Consists of 2 twin beds stacked one on top of the other. Ideal for making the most of sleeping space.
Loft Bed
Features a raised leading bed with the lower space exposed for a desk, couch, or additional storage. Perfect for studying and developing a cozy hangout space.
Futon Bunk Bed
Features a twin bed on leading and a futon on the bottom, enabling flexible use as seating throughout the day and sleeping in the evening.
Twin over Full Bunk Bed
Uses a twin bed on the top and a complete bed on the bottom, accommodating various sleeping plans for good friends and siblings.
Triple Bunk Bed
Designed for 3 sleepers, this type can be especially efficient in siblings' spaces or throughout slumber parties.
Customized Bunk Bed Designs
Customized choices can consist of integrated racks, desks, or perhaps themed designs, allowing for personalization that shows a teenager's design.
Considerations When Choosing Bunk Beds
Selecting the right bunk bed for a teen involves more than just visual appeal. Here are some key elements to think about:
1. Safety
- Ensure that the bunk bed complies with security standards, featuring guardrails on the top bunk and a tough ladder.
- Height is also important; taller beds might need more careful consideration relating to safety.
2. Material
- Bunk beds can be made from different materials, including wood, metal, and particleboard. Each offers varying levels of resilience and design:
- Wood: Provides a timeless and strong appearance, often preferred for its durability.
- Metal: Offers a modern aesthetic, frequently lighter and more modern in style.
- Particleboard: An affordable option but might not be as long lasting long-lasting.
3. Size
- Consider the room size where the bed will be put. Ensure to measure height, width, and floor space.
- Ensure there suffices room for the teen to get in and out of bed conveniently, in addition to space for any additional furniture.
4. Style
- Bunk beds are readily available in numerous designs, from minimalist, modern designs to rustic or themed choices. Select one that reflects the teen's personality and room decor.
5. Performance

Maintenance and Care
To ensure the longevity of a bunk bed, think about the following upkeep pointers:
- Regularly Check Bolts and Screws: Periodically examine all connections for wear and tighten as required.
- Clean: Regularly dust and clean bed mattress, frames, and surrounding locations to keep hygiene.
- Turn Mattresses: Rotating the mattresses can help prevent drooping and prolong their life.
- Protective Measures: Consider using a bed mattress protector to alleviate spills and stains.
